随着区块链技术的发展,数字资产的使用越来越普及。以太坊作为最流行的智能合约平台之一,为用户提供了丰富的功能,其中之一就是在以太坊钱包中授权他人操作用户的资产。本文将详细介绍如何在以太坊钱包中进行授权,并围绕用户在这一过程中可能遇到的问题进行深入探讨。
什么是以太坊钱包授权?
以太坊钱包授权是指用户在其以太坊钱包中允许第三方(通常是DApp或智能合约)操作其数字资产的一种机制。在区块链的世界中,资产控制权通常归用户所有,而授权则是用户将某些操作的控制权临时交给他人的过程。
例如,当用户希望使用某个去中心化的交易所进行交易,但该交易所需要访问用户的钱包中的资产时,用户就需要进行授权。授予授权后,该交易所将能够替用户进行一些指定的操作,例如转账或交易等。
如何在以太坊钱包中进行授权?
授权过程通常包括以下几个步骤:
- 选择合适的钱包:首先,用户需要拥有一个支持以太坊的数字钱包,如MetaMask、Trust Wallet等。确保钱包已正确设置并与以太坊网络连接。
- 连接到DApp或智能合约:用户需要访问需要进行授权的DApp或智能合约,并在钱包中进行连接。这通常通过扫描二维码或者直接输入DApp网址实现。
- 发起授权请求:在DApp界面,用户通常可以找到“授权”或“连接钱包”等选项。通过点击该选项,用户将进入授权流程。
- 确认授权细节:用户需要仔细审查授权请求中的细节,例如授权金额、有效期等。在确认无误后,用户可进行下一步。
- 签署交易:用户通常需要在钱包中签署该交易。在MetaMask中,用户会看到弹窗,显示授权的相关信息。用户应仔细检查后,点击“确认”进行交易签署。
- 等待交易确认:提交交易后,用户需耐心等待以太坊网络的确认,这通常需要一段时间,取决于网络的拥堵程度。
授权的风险与安全性
虽然授权为用户提供了便捷的操作方式,但也伴随着一定的风险。用户需要注意以下几点:
- 恶意DApp:用户在授权给某个DApp之前,应充分了解该DApp的信誉、评价及其开发团队的背景。恶意DApp可能会滥用用户的授权,导致资产被盗或遭到损失。
- 过度授权:用户在授权时,应仔细核对所授权的额度。若授权额度过大,可能在恶意操作下带来巨大的损失。
- 撤回授权:一旦完成授权,用户应定期检查已授权的合约或地址,并在不再需要时及时撤回授权,避免潜在的风险。
授权的场景与应用
在以太坊生态中,授权涉及的场景多种多样,主要包括:
- 去中心化交易所(DEX):用户授权DEX访问其账户余额,以便进行交易或流动性提供。
- 借贷协议:用户在借贷协议中授权合约以便于借出资产,或以质押资产获得贷款。
- NFT市场:用户在NFT市场上出售或转让NFT时,需要授权市场合约访问其NFT资产。
- 代币交换: 用户授权交换合约以便于完成代币之间的互换。
- 流动性挖矿: 用户授权流动性池合约以提供流动性,并获得代币奖励。
撤回授权的步骤
撤回授权是保障用户数字资产安全的重要措施之一。用户可以遵循以下步骤进行授权撤回:
- 访问智能合约:用户可以使用Etherscan等区块链浏览器查询自己已授权的合约地址,了解目前的授权状态。
- 使用专用工具:用户可以使用一些常见的撤回授权工具,比如Revoke.cash等,输入自己的钱包地址,查找已授权的合约。
- 选择要撤回的合约:在找到已授权的合约后,用户可以选择需要撤回的合约,并进行撤回操作。
- 确认交易:撤回授权同样需要用户在钱包中确认交易,确保信息无误后进行签署。
- 等待确认:提交交易后同样需要等待网络的确认,确认完成后授权即正式撤回。
相关问题探讨
1. 什么情况下需要给他人授权?
用户授权的情况非常多样化,其背后的需求通常源于希望更方便地管理数字资产。以下是一些常见场景:
- 参与DeFi项目:随着去中心化金融(DeFi)的兴起,很多用户希望将资产参与到借贷、流动性挖矿等项目中。用户需要授权相关合约来进行这些操作。
- 交易和转让NFT:在进行NFT交易时,用户需要授权市场合约来访问其NFT资产。此过程通常需要在购买或出售时进行。
- 参与DAO治理:如果用户希望参与某个去中心化自治组织(DAO)的投票与治理,他们可能需要授权相关合约以便于进行投票操作。
- 参与DApp交互:用户在某些DApp中进行操作(比如游戏、在线社交等),常常需要授权以便于访问用户的资产。
因此,用户授权的必要性在于提高使用便利性与功能获得,然而,在进行授权时用户务必谨慎,确保操作的安全性。
2. 授权后如何防止资产被盗?
在进行资产授权后,用户应采取一些预防措施来保护自己的财产,以下是几项建议:
- 谨慎选择合约:确保所授权的DApp或合约为可信且有良好口碑的项目,避免与无名或疑似诈骗的项目进行交易。
- 定期查看授权状态:用户应定期登录其钱包或使用区块链浏览器检查当前已授权的合约或地址,随时了解可能的风险。
- 设置授权额度:在授权时,尽量设置一个最小的授权额度,这样即使被恶意合约访问,也不会造成过大的损失。
- 及时撤回不必要的授权:用户在不再需要某个合约访问其资产时,务必及时进行撤回,以降低风险。
- 使用硬件钱包:为提高资产管理的安全性,用户可以考虑使用硬件钱包进行资产存储,避免私钥泄露的风险。
3. 支持以太坊授权的钱包有哪些?
许多数字钱包提供对以太坊资产的支持及授权功能,以下是一些流行的钱包:
- MetaMask:作为最流行的以太坊钱包之一,MetaMask不仅支持浏览器插件,还提供移动应用,用户可以方便地进行授权、交易、签署合约等操作。
- Trust Wallet:这是Binance官方推出的一个移动钱包,支持多种加密货币。用户可轻松进行授权及交易等操作。
- MyEtherWallet(MEW):这是一个开源以太坊钱包,用户可选择不同的方式管理自己的资产,并进行授权等操作。
- Ledger Nano S/X:作为硬件钱包,它提供业内领先的安全性,用户在使用时可通过结合其他钱包进行授权操作,以提高安全性。
4. 有哪些工具可以用于管理以太坊授权?
市场上有多种工具可以帮助用户管理和撤回以太坊授权。以下是一些主流工具:
- Revoke.cash:这是一个直观易用的工具,用户只需输入以太坊地址即可查看所有授权,并可以方便地调用撤回功能。
- Etherscan.io:这是一个常用的区块链浏览器,用户可以通过搜索地址,查阅其资产及授权的合约信息。
- Zapper.fi:此平台为用户提供综合的DeFi管理工具,用户能方便地查看授权状态,并一键进行撤回。
- TokenApproval.com:这是另一个帮助用户寻找和管理已授权合约的工具,便于用户进行全面的风险评估。
5. 授权后是否可以随时撤回?
用户在授权后随时可以进行撤回操作。撤回授权至关重要,因为这能有效降低用户的数字资产风险。用户通过相应的工具或钱包进行撤回,一般都会提供详细的操作提示,以确保用户能够顺利完成。
在撤回授权后,需要注意以下几点:
- 交易费用:撤回授权同样需要支付一定的交易费用,用户在操作前需确保钱包中有足够的ETH以支付网络费用。
- 授权状态更新:授权撤回后,用户可以通过区块链浏览器或管理工具确认授权状态,以确保撤回操作生效。
- 及时检查:用户应在撤回后定期检查其钱包授权情况,避免出现任何遗留的授权合约。
总之,以太坊钱包的授权机制为用户提供了便捷的资产管理方式,但安全性及风险控制不容忽视。用户在授权前需做好功课,确保理解授权的机制,临时授权时量力而行,而在不再需要授权时及时撤回以保障自身资产安全。通过本文的详细介绍,相信用户能够有效掌握以太坊钱包的授权过程,明智地进行资产管理。